I don't know of any places that have poetry full time but there are places that have poetry slams or open mics, like Studio Joe (West Little Rock, off Chenal), ACAC (near Kanis Park on Rodney Parham), and Vino's (downtown).

As for jazz, try the Afterthought and Vieux Carre in Hillcrest, or the Capitol Hotel Bar, downtown. Crush is a good suggestion for a lounge-y atmosphere; also there a couple of piano bars in the River Market.

Jazzi's and Elevations on Asher are hip-hop/R&B clubs that are really hopping on weekends.

Cornerstone Pub and Bogie's in NLR/Argenta might also be good places to check out.
